Web17.52.130 Limitations on Changes of Terms and Conditions of Tenancy. In the City of West Hollywood, a landlord cannot evict or relocate a tenant except for certain specific reasons. These reasons, listed in the Rent Stabilization Ordinance at Section 17.52.010, are commonly referred to as "just cause evictions" and "tenant relocations". WebJan 5, 2024 · If a property owner illegally evicts a tenant, the tenant may sue the landlord for a wide variety of things depending on the circumstances of the eviction: Intentional infliction of emotional distress. A tenant's behavior will not shield a landlord from liability. Instead, a court may view the landlord's unlawful actions as landlord harassment. WebAn owner may not evict a tenant by use of force or unlawful means.
